Earth Nourishment Retreat

Immerse yourself in our serene five-acre spa retreat in West Sonoma County for a day of transformative self-care. To begin, your journey starts with a morning of relaxation, including a group cedar enzyme footbath, your choice of a 70-minute massage or a 65-minute custom facial, peaceful walking meditation through our bamboo forest, and guided meditation in our renowned Japanese garden.  Following this, a nourishing lunch, crafted by a local chef with fresh, wholesome ingredients will be offered in a magical creekside setting beneath the shade of oak and bay trees.

In the afternoon, Taylor Houston will guide you to connect deeply with the natural world, your own inner rhythms, and the healing energy of the land. To begin, she will lead a brief educational session that helps you align your lifestyle, eating habits, and self-care practices with the current season. Specifically, she will introduce seasonal herbs, foods, and rhythms that support vitality.

Next, we will activate and support the lymphatic system through gentle movement and by creating your own seasonal salt scrub using mineral salts and lymphatic-supportive herbs. As you blend your scrub, you’ll learn how the lymphatic system supports detoxification and immunity, and how to care for it naturally.

Afterward, we will conclude the afternoon with a guided meditation in communion with the spirit of rose — a plant teacher of the heart. You’ll work with rose flower essence and rose tea, and then reflect on the experience through journaling.

This retreat grounds itself in herbalism, intentional movement, and seasonal nutrition to offer a restorative blend of education, embodiment, and sensory engagement. You will leave feeling deeply rooted, refreshed, and empowered with tools to carry the spirit of the retreat into your daily life.
